But it clearly isn’t as simple as adding those up. There are styles of play and systems to consider. For example. Tella played central a lot. He wouldn’t have here. Adams might have been in a two man strike partnership (I can’t remember). Adams’ goals might have come from the Tella equivalent in that team being involved in the creation rather than the scoring - reducing one tally

But sure a pithy comment is suitable here and football is just a simple game of finding a player who scored X goals last season and they will automatically score X goals this season.

My favourite example of this was when Chelsea signed Shevchenko and Ballack and the sports papers were salivating over Shevchenko and (I think) Drogba getting close to 30 goals each and Ballack and Lampard each getting 20 for an automatic 100 goals. Based on prior records at different clubs. And ignoring that they had one of the most defensive managers in recent eras. That still sticks out to me because I knew that was laughable at the time and proved to be. Pretty sure they were still really successful. But those goal returns simply did not happen
